Gluten Free Chocolate Cake for a Higher Purpose

  1. In a large bowl mix together all of the dry cake ingredients.
  2. In another bowl mix together the milk, whole egg, egg yolk, and extracts.
  3. Add the wet ingredients to the dry and mix together with a mixer on medium speed for about one minute.
  4. Add hot water to batter and mix until entirely incorporated.
  5. Divide batter into 2 greased 8-inch cake pans and cook in a preheated 350 degrees oven for about 25 minutes.
  6. Check the centers with toothpick to make sure they are done.
  7. Remove from oven and let cool 10 minutes then use a knife around the edges to help remove it from the pan to cool further.
  8. Use as a base for your favorite chocolate cake recipe.
  9. Flour mix: Blend all flours together thoroughly and use in this recipe, and store remaining in an airtight container to use in other recipes.

sugar, flour, xanthan gum, cocoa, baking powder, baking soda, salt, milk, egg, egg, vanilla, water, starch, sorghum, brown rice flour
